Bobby Dodd Stadium Gets New Seats
from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ets Football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now!
Georgia Tech’s Bobby Dodd Stadium is getting a $70 million makeover, ready for the 2027 season — the first major upgrade since 2003. Originally planned with flip-up chairs, modern video boards, and premium zones, engineers hit a wall: the stadium’s narrow tread depth (as tight as 26.5 inches) won’t fit modern seats without cutting capacity or blowing the budget. Instead, they’re installing bolt-on chairback seats — tested and approved by fans — that fit snugly on existing bleachers. While some areas remain cramped, new aisles and handrails improve safety and comfort. The final count? 12,500 new seats, bringing total capacity to 50,000 — up from the original 42,000 — meaning more fans can roar for the Yellow Jackets.
